Answer:
5 digits
Explanation:
From the question above,we are asked to find out the number of digits that will proceed after the decimal point.
And were provided with the information that a standard Lego brick has the following dimensions:
Length of the brick is 1.25 inches
Width of the brick is 0.625 inches.
From here,the area of the brick(which is rectangular in shape) is length multiplied by the width
L×W
1.25×0.625
=0.78125
Now we can see that the digits 78125 proceeded after the decimal point.
Therefore, the number of digits that proceeds after the decimal is 5
